After Ange notched up another win in last nights 2-0 home tie against St Mirren, the panel on BBC Sportsound were discussing the bizarre post match interview that Ange had just given to Kenny MacIntyre when it was revealed that the Celtic boss was very supportive of young managers in Scotland behind the scenes.

James McPake was a guest on the show and he revealed that Ange was a source of great advice to him whilst he was in the dugout for the Dens Park side, “At the Dundee game he came out and says he was delighted that they got the win in the end because they controlled the game.

“At Hibs on Sunday when they played up there he says they were in complete control, all the all the game lacked was a goal.

“And he was very happy with the performance.

“And tonight again he’s just come out and says, ‘Teams are going to sit in, I was delighted with the way we played. And we won the game.’

“And he throws that  ‘mate’ word in all the time that just makes him sound or so calm, so relaxed.

“And as I went back to and alluded to at the start of the programme, he’s great to talk to and he gives great advice.

“And to be able to stand and be as calm as that, then if that’s  honestly the way he is, then credit to him, because I think it’s brilliant.”

And it’s these small touches of class that Postecoglou does behind the scenes that go unnoticed or unheard of by the wider support that are making the Hoops gaffer one of the most respected men in the game.
